What price range should I expect to replace one or both head gaskets to fix a leaking head gasket? Also should I consider having the timing belt replaced at the same time with 94,000 miles on the car. And how much extra should the timing belt replacement cost.

Each head gasket is gong to run you about $20 while labor will be anywhere from $2000-$3000. You should change your timing belt around every 120,000 miles. Since the engine must be dismantle anyway to reach the HG's, it would be a good idea to get your timing belt changed in the process. This way you won't be paying them again for labor in a year or two for something they had to take off while changing the HG's anyway. The timing belt should only run you about $70.
